Chemistry Glossary

Alloy

Alloy - a mixture formed by mixing a metal with other metals or non-metals

Body-centred cubic structure

Brass

Brass - an alloy of copper and zinc

Cholesteric

Coordination number

Coordination number - the number of atoms (or ions) immediately surrounding an atom (or ion) in a crystal lattice

Cubic close-packed structure

Director

Director - the preferred direction in which the molecules in the nematic phase tend to point

Face-centred cubic unit cell

Face-centred cubic unit cell - a unit cell with cubic close-packed metallic crystal structure where each of its six faces has one atom

Hexagonal close-packed structure

Interstitial alloy

Interstitial alloy - a type of alloy where smaller atoms fit into holes among the closely packed host metallic atoms

Liquid crystal phase

Nematic

Nematic - molecules in this phase tend to point in the same direction

Smectic

Smectic - molecules in this phase show some degree of two-dimensional order; they align towards the direction of the director and tend to arrange in layers

Stainless steel

Stainless steel - an alloy by iron, chromium and nickel

Substitutional alloy

Substitutional alloy - a type of alloy where some of the host metallic atoms are replaced by the other metallic atoms

Unit cell

Unit cell - the simplest arrangement of atoms (or ions) which when repeated will reproduce the whole structure
